Toulouse's wonderkid Amine Adli, who has just been awarded as the best player in the Ligue 2 this season, is reportedly followed by AC Milan, among others, ahead of the next summer transfer window; the 21-year-old is few months away from entering the last year of his contract with the French club.
According to the latest informations provided by Footmercato, Milan, Bayer Leverkusen and Olympique de Marseille have taken concrete steps to land the young frontman, either towards his entourage or directly to the club. They have already proposed him a contract. Oral offers have even already been sent.
Yet, the financial requests of club president Damien Comoli have not been met by any suitor, as the Ligue 2 side will not let its rising star go for less than 15 million euros, as reported by the same source.
